Screen Humidity Degrees Frequently



Normal tracking of humidity degrees is crucial in ensuring the effectiveness of blog post mold and mildew removal efforts. After completing mold remediation procedures, keeping ideal humidity degrees is crucial to stop mold re-growth and make sure a healthy indoor setting. Tracking humidity levels permits early discovery of any spikes or variations that could possibly result in mold and mildew revival. High moisture levels over 60% produce a favorable atmosphere for mold to flourish, making regular keeping track of a proactive measure to stop any future mold issues - Post Remediation Inspection near me.


Furthermore, establishing a regular timetable for moisture checks, especially in high-risk locations such as washrooms, kitchens, and basements, is a proactive approach to mold and mildew avoidance. By constantly keeping track of humidity levels, residential or commercial property proprietors can properly reduce the threat of mold and mildew reoccurrence and maintain a healthy interior setting post-remediation.


Conduct Thorough Inspections Post-Remediation



Complying with the conclusion of mold removal procedures, it is critical to carry out detailed assessments to validate the effectiveness of the removal procedure. These post-remediation examinations are vital in ensuring that the mold issue has been effectively attended to and that there is no reappearance or staying mold and mildew growth. Evaluations need to be accomplished by certified experts who have knowledge in determining mold and analyzing interior air quality.


During these assessments, various methods such as aesthetic analyses, air tasting, and surface sampling may be used to thoroughly assess the remediated locations. Aesthetic analyses entail a detailed evaluation of the facilities to inspect for any type of noticeable indications of mold and mildew growth or water damages. Air tasting aids in establishing the air-borne mold and mildew spore degrees, while surface sampling can spot mold particles on surfaces.

Use Mold-Resistant Products for Services



To boost the lasting performance of mold remediation efforts, integrating mold-resistant materials for repair work is crucial in reducing the risk of future mold and mildew growth. Mold-resistant materials are made to withstand moisture and inhibit mold and mildew growth, making them an important option for areas vulnerable to dampness and moisture. When fixing locations impacted by mold and mildew, making use of products such as mold-resistant drywall, mold-resistant paints, and mold-resistant caulking can assist stop mold reappearance.




Mold-resistant drywall is an excellent choice to typical drywall in locations like washrooms and cellars where wetness levels are higher. This kind of drywall has an unique coating that resists mold and mildew growth also when revealed to damp problems. In addition, using mold-resistant paints including antimicrobial agents can even more prevent mold pop over to this site advancement on ceilings and wall surfaces.




In locations where dampness is common, such as washrooms and kitchens, using mold-resistant caulking around sinks, bathtubs, and home windows can assist seal out water and stop mold and mildew from holding in splits and holes. By purchasing these mold-resistant products throughout fixings post-remediation, you can considerably decrease the probability of future mold and mildew problems and maintain a much healthier interior environment.
